This webinar recording shares practical solutions for mechanics and winders to overcome common challenges and streamline their daily work.

Have you ever fought to remove a stuck end bracket, broken a bolt, or struggled to remove a bearing from a blind housing? Discovered that a keyway is worn oversized when your customer is screaming to get the motor back in service? How about dealing with rough iron when rewinding a stator or armature, trying not to scratch a wire, or rewound a low-speed motor that has continuously overheated? If any of these challenges sound familiar, this presentation is for you. 

Topics include: 

  • Techniques for removing stubborn end brackets without damage 
  • Bearing removal strategies for difficult blind housing configurations 
  • Quick fixes for worn keyways when time is critical 
  • Thermal management solutions for problematic low-speed motor designs 
  • Preventative maintenance practices  

Target Audience: Supervisors, machinists, mechanics, and winders will benefit from this webinar.
